Tour Overview

This private full-day tour offers an immersive exploration of the stunning Costa Brava region from Barcelona.
Guests can visit the Dalí Theater-Museum in Figueres, known for its surreal and whimsical artworks. After, they’ll have free time in a charming fishing village to swim or enjoy local cuisine.
The tour also includes a wine tasting at a renowned winery in Emporda, where travelers can sample the region’s distinctive varietals and enjoy tapas.

What Is the Dress Code for the Tour?
There is no specific dress code mentioned for the tour. The tour takes place in various outdoor locations, so comfortable and weather-appropriate clothing is recommended. Guests should dress in a casual and comfortable manner for the activities and experiences included in the tour.
Can We Bring Our Own Food and Drinks?
No, outside food and drinks are not permitted on this private tour. The tour includes alcoholic beverages, brunch, and tapas as part of the package, so guests are expected to enjoy the provided refreshments during the experience.
Are There Any Dietary Restrictions Accommodated?
The tour can accommodate dietary restrictions. Guests should inform the local provider of any special dietary needs at the time of booking, and the provider will work to accommodate those requirements during the tour.
Can We Extend the Tour Duration if Needed?
The tour allows for flexibility in itinerary adjustments. Guests can discuss extending the tour duration with the local provider at an additional cost if needed to accommodate their preferences.
How Many Stops Are Made During the Tour?
The tour makes 3 stops during the day: Figueres to visit the Dalí Theater-Museum, a fishing village for free time, and a winery in Emporda for a wine tasting. The specific itinerary can be adjusted based on the preferences of the travelers.
